    With all due respect to Upendra Ji Bhat, Carnatic Sangeet " Pitamaha" is the great Sage " Purandara dasa" from Karnataka and the one who structured and formulated the basic lessons of teaching Carnatic music by structuring graded exercises known as Svaravalis and Alankaras.Thyagaraj himself praised Purandara dasa in many of his compositions. Saying Carnatic music has nothing to do with Karnataka is absolutely wrong. And also I see many people here refer Carnatic ( Carna=ears) means - soothing to ears which is not correct. During 11- 16th Century the major parts of Karnataka, Tamilnadu, Kerala, Andhra pradesh and also few parts of Maharashtra were considered as Carnatic region and the music originated there was known as Carnatic music.

    The video is very pleasing. I have enjoyed watching it. But, I have a humble submission. At 5.0 minutes, Sri Upendraji Bhat says that the name Karnatak Sangeet has nothing to do with Karnataka State and is more prevalent in TN and Andhra Pradesh. To a limited extent this is correct- Karnatak Sangeet is practised only in southern part of the State. In northern part of Karnataka, Hindustani music is prevalent. The name Karnatak Sangeet came to this system of Music because of Sri Purandara Dasa a highly acclaimed Haridasa or vaishnavait saint of 15-16th century. He substantially gave the present form to Karnatak Music. The basic lessons of Karnatak music set by him are followed even today (after more than five centuries) in all places where Karnatak music is taught. He is referred to as Karnataka Sangeeta Pitamah. Venkatamakhi and Mutuswamy Dikshitar are two other great people who gave present form to Karnatak music. What I have stated here can be verified from any basic text book of Karnatak Music.🙏🏼

    If you are introducing hamsadwani, I am surprised that no mention is made of Shri Muthuswami Dikshitar. He is the first composer to really bring this raag out, with the most well known composition in this raag, vAtApi gaNapathIm, which is what most Hindustani musicians tend to present in one form or the other, although there are many other Carnatic compositions in this raag.
